Abstract

Systems and methods are described herein for providing content for consumption on a mobile device by temporarily licensing the content to the mobile device while the mobile device is travelling between two locations having media devices licensed to provide the content for consumption, or while temporarily outside a location having a media device licensed to provide the content for consumption. Upon detecting that the mobile device is leaving a location at which the content is being provided it is determined whether the mobile device is within a threshold distance of the location, or if the content is licensed to be provided for consumption by a media device at an identified destination. The content is temporarily licensed for consumption on the mobile device to allow the mobile device to provide the content for consumption while outside the first location or while travelling to the second location.

Claims (81)

1. A method for providing content for consumption on a mobile device, the method comprising:

receiving, from a mobile device, a current location of the mobile device, and an identifier of content being provided for consumption at the current location;

receiving, from the mobile device, a location of a destination of the mobile device;

determining whether the content is licensed for consumption at the destination; and

in response to determining that the content is licensed for consumption at the destination, granting a temporary license for the content to the mobile device.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ein receiving, from the mobile device, the location of a destination comprises receiving, from the mobile device, one of an input destination from a ride-hailing application, a location of an event from a calendar, and an input destination from a navigation application.

3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

receiving, from the mobile device, an updated location of the mobile device;

determining, based on the updated location, whether the mobile device has reached the destination; and

in response to determining that the mobile device has reached the destination, revoking the temporary license.

4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

receiving, from the mobile device, an updated location of the mobile device;

determining, based on the updated location, whether the mobile device has reached the destination;

in response to determining that the mobile device has reached the destination, determining whether a media device at the destination is currently providing the content for consumption;

in response to determining that the media device at the destination is currently providing the content for consumption, revoking the temporary license; and

in response to determining that the media device at the destination is not currently providing the content for consumption:

periodically determining whether the media device at the destination is providing the content for consumption; and

in response to determining that the media device at the destination is providing the content for consumption, revoking the temporary license.

5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

predicting an amount of time needed to reach the destination from the current location;

determining whether the predicted amount of time has passed; and

in response to determining that the predicted amount of time has passed, revoking the temporary license.

6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

determining whether an account associated with the mobile device is licensed to provide the content for consumption; and

in response to determining that the account associated with the mobile device is licensed to provide the content for consumption, presenting an option on the mobile device to begin recording the content.

7. The method of claim 6 , further comprising:

receiving, from the mobile device, a request to record the content; and

in response to receiving the request, recording the content from at least a time at which the request was received.

8. The method of claim 6 , further comprising:

receiving an updated location from the media device;

determining, based on the updated location, that the mobile device is en route to the destination; and

in response to determining that the mobile device is en route to the destination, recording the content from at least a time at which the updated location was received.

9.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

identifying a content stream corresponding to the content; and

transmitting a copy of the content stream corresponding to the content to the mobile device beginning from a current live playback point.

10. The method of claim 9 , further comprising:

identifying a content provider of the content stream;

transmitting a request for a new stream connection to the content provider; and

creating a stream connection between the content provider and the mobile device.
